Quote:
Originally Posted by LittleRedHen View Post
Oh no no no no.

Here's a quote from Bankrate.com about dealer prep charges:

"Dealer preparation, or dealer prep or preparation charges -- An additional charge that dealers try to impose on buyers. It represents pure profit for the dealers, who have already been paid by the manufacturer for the cost of preparing the car for sale."
You & I don't live in the SET Region. Down there there is an extra charge tacked on to every car that seems to be non-negotiable. To avoid this charge the OP would have to buy the car out of state.

We also are from the Daytona area & bought our 2006 Prius August one year ago from the dealer here in town who at a time, they charged nothing over the FACTORY MSRP, & the dealer fee was down to $200. About one month ago they were several thousand over factory MSRP. I say the FACTORY MSRP & not the dealer "add on" sticker that looks looks alot like an extension of the factory sticker & is right next to the factory MSRP sticker.
We also recently bought a 2008 Highlander Hybrid Limited from Earl Stewart Toyota in North Palm Beach FL for $3200 under facory MSRP & NO DEALER FEE ! That is their policy, no dealer fee. It was well worth the drive !!
